First pair of TCB's with the 50s denim, the 50s Slim T. Pretty much zero break-in period and they are comfortable from the first wear. I was stuck between Full Count 1103 or these. Chose the TCBs because the fit looked a little cleaner with the mid-rise and a little more trim through the thighs. They seem like a very "adult" slim taper and look great with my chelsea boots or sneakers. I went with size 31, same as my TCB 60s. Pretty similar top-block measurements aside from the rise and maybe slightly slimmer thighs on these.4 points
